Financial Analyst Salary in Denver, Colorado

The median financial analyst salary in Denver, CO is $106,490 per year, which is 12.0% above the national median and 6.7% above the Colorado state average.

Financial Analyst Salary in Denver by Experience

In Denver, an entry-level financial analyst earns around $67,200, while experienced professionals earn up to $165,760 per year. The local cost of living index is 112% of the national average.

Entry Level (0-2 yrs)
$67,200
+$7,200 vs national
Mid Level (3-7 yrs)
$107,520
+$11,520 vs national
Senior Level (8+ yrs)
$165,760
+$17,760 vs national

Salary Percentiles in Denver, CO

Percentile Denver
10th Percentile $64,064
25th Percentile $81,536
Median (50th) $106,490
75th Percentile $140,000
90th Percentile $186,592

Frequently Asked Questions: Financial Analyst Salary in Denver

How much does a Financial Analyst make in Denver, CO?
The median financial analyst salary in Denver, Colorado is $106,490 per year, which is 12.0% above the national median of $95,080. Salaries range from $64,064 (10th percentile) to $186,592 (90th percentile).
How much does a Financial Analyst make per hour in Denver?
Based on the median annual salary of $106,490, a financial analyst in Denver earns approximately $51 per hour assuming a standard 2,080-hour work year.
How does Denver compare to the Colorado state average for financial analyst pay?
Denver's median financial analyst salary of $106,490 is 6.7% above the Colorado state average of $99,834. The local cost of living index is 112% of the national average.
What is the cost of living in Denver, CO?
Denver has a cost of living index of 112% compared to the national average. This means a financial analyst salary of $106,490 in Denver has less purchasing power than the same salary in an average-cost city.
